1. Foundations of Weight Loss in a Clinical Context

Foundations of Weight Loss in a Clinical Context

From a clinical perspective, sustainable weight loss is governed by the principle of energy balance. This is the well-established relationship between calories consumed through food and beverages and calories expended through basal metabolic rate, physical activity, and the thermic effect of food. To lose weight, one must create a consistent energy deficit, where expenditure exceeds intake.

However, the human body is not a simple calculator. Physiological adaptations, often termed "metabolic adaptation," can occur in response to weight loss, potentially slowing metabolic rate and increasing hunger hormones. This underscores why rapid, aggressive approaches often lead to unsustainable results and weight regain. A target of losing 20 pounds in 2 months represents a significant deficit of approximately 1,250 calories per day, which is at the upper limit of what many clinical guidelines consider safe and sustainable without medical supervision.

Clinical Insight: In practice, clinicians prioritize a moderate, consistent deficit that preserves lean muscle mass and supports metabolic health. A loss of 1-2 pounds per week is the typical benchmark, as it is more manageable and linked to better long-term maintenance. The more aggressive the timeline, the greater the need for careful nutritional planning and professional oversight to mitigate risks like nutrient deficiencies, gallstones, or loss of muscle mass.

The most robust evidence supports a combined approach of dietary modification and increased physical activity. Key dietary foundations include:

  • Prioritizing Nutrient Density: Focusing on whole foods—vegetables, lean proteins, whole grains, and healthy fats—maximizes satiety and micronutrient intake per calorie.
  • Managing Portions: Calorie awareness, whether through formal tracking or mindful eating practices, is strongly correlated with successful weight loss.
  • Reducing Ultra-Processed Foods: High evidence links these foods to overconsumption due to their engineered palatability and low satiety.

It is crucial to note that individual factors—genetics, medical conditions (e.g., hypothyroidism, PCOS), medications (e.g., some antidepressants, antipsychotics), and lifestyle—profoundly influence the rate and ease of weight loss. Therefore, a one-size-fits-all approach is not clinically sound.

Who should proceed with caution: Individuals with a history of eating disorders, significant kidney or liver disease, type 1 diabetes, or those who are pregnant or breastfeeding must consult a physician before initiating any weight loss plan. Anyone on multiple medications or with a complex medical history should also seek personalized medical advice to ensure safety.

2. Evidence-Based Mechanisms of Exercise and Diet Synergy

Evidence-Based Mechanisms of Exercise and Diet Synergy

The goal of losing 20 pounds in two months is ambitious and requires a significant, sustained caloric deficit. The synergy between diet and exercise is not merely additive; it creates a more sustainable and physiologically favorable environment for weight loss than either approach alone. The combined strategy works through several well-established mechanisms.

Creating a Manageable Caloric Deficit

A diet creates the primary deficit, while exercise expands it without requiring further drastic food restriction. This is crucial for adherence and nutritional adequacy. For instance, a moderate daily deficit of 500 calories from diet, combined with an additional 250-calorie expenditure from exercise, creates a 750-calorie daily deficit. This aligns more closely with the weekly deficit needed for a two-pound weight loss, which is generally considered a safe upper limit.

Preserving Lean Mass and Metabolic Rate

This is a key area where exercise, particularly resistance training, provides critical synergy. During caloric restriction, the body loses both fat and lean tissue, including muscle. Muscle mass is metabolically active; losing it can lower your resting metabolic rate (RMR), making long-term weight maintenance harder. Exercise, especially strength training, provides an anabolic signal that helps preserve lean mass, ensuring a greater proportion of weight lost comes from fat stores.

Clinical Insight: The preservation of lean mass is one of the most evidence-backed benefits of combining diet with exercise. While diet-alone weight loss can lead to a loss of 20-30% of weight from lean tissue, incorporating resistance exercise can reduce that proportion significantly. This has direct implications for metabolic health and functional mobility.

Enhancing Insulin Sensitivity and Appetite Regulation

Both diet quality and exercise independently improve insulin sensitivity, allowing for better blood sugar control and potentially reducing fat storage. Furthermore, certain types of exercise, particularly high-intensity interval training (HIIT) and resistance training, may have a modest modulating effect on appetite hormones like ghrelin and peptide YY, though the evidence here is more mixed and individual responses vary widely.

Important Considerations and Cautions

The evidence for these synergistic mechanisms is strong in principle, but individual results can vary based on genetics, adherence, and starting point. It is also critical to note that an aggressive deficit and exercise regimen is not appropriate for everyone.

  • Seek medical advice before starting if you have pre-existing conditions like cardiovascular disease, diabetes, orthopedic issues, or a history of eating disorders.
  • Individuals on certain medications or with kidney/liver disease require personalized guidance.
  • The proposed timeline and weight loss goal are intensive; sustainability after the two-month period requires a carefully planned transition to a long-term maintenance strategy.

In summary, the synergy between diet and exercise facilitates a larger caloric deficit while protecting metabolic health and physical function, creating a more effective and sustainable path to significant weight loss.

3. Contraindications and Populations at Higher Risk

Contraindications and Populations at Higher Risk

While the principles of a calorie deficit through diet and exercise are broadly applicable, a structured plan to lose 20 pounds in two months is an aggressive goal that is not appropriate or safe for everyone. The intensity and caloric restriction required can pose significant health risks for specific populations. It is clinically imperative to identify individuals for whom this approach is contraindicated or who require close medical supervision.

Absolute and Relative Contraindications

Certain medical conditions make rapid weight loss dangerous. An aggressive plan is generally contraindicated for individuals with:

  • Active cardiovascular disease: This includes unstable angina, recent myocardial infarction, or severe heart failure. Sudden increases in exercise intensity or severe dietary changes can strain the cardiovascular system.
  • Unmanaged type 1 or type 2 diabetes: Drastic changes in food intake and activity can lead to dangerous hypoglycemia or hyperglycemia, requiring careful medication adjustment.
  • History of eating disorders: Structured, rapid weight loss plans can trigger relapse in individuals with anorexia nervosa, bulimia, or binge-eating disorder.
  • Pregnancy and lactation: Caloric and nutrient needs are significantly higher during these periods. Weight loss is not recommended without explicit guidance from an obstetrician.

Populations Requiring Medical Consultation

Individuals with the following conditions should consult a physician (e.g., primary care doctor, cardiologist, endocrinologist) before embarking on any aggressive weight loss plan to ensure safety and appropriate modifications:

  • Chronic kidney or liver disease: Protein intake and fluid balance must be carefully managed.
  • Osteoporosis or high fracture risk: Rapid weight loss, especially without resistance training, can accelerate bone mineral density loss.
  • Individuals on multiple medications (polypharmacy): Weight loss can alter the metabolism and efficacy of many drugs, including those for blood pressure, diabetes, and mental health.
  • Those with a BMI under 20 or who are already at a medically healthy weight: Pursuing rapid weight loss in this context can lead to malnutrition and metabolic dysfunction.

Clinical Perspective: From a medical standpoint, the primary concern with rapid weight loss protocols is not just the rate of loss, but the potential for exacerbating underlying conditions and promoting loss of lean muscle mass. A responsible clinician will always prioritize screening for these contraindications. For most individuals in higher-risk categories, a slower, more moderate approach supervised by a healthcare team—including a registered dietitian—is the evidence-based standard of care for sustainable and safe weight management.

Ultimately, the safest approach is to undergo a basic health screening with a healthcare provider to discuss personal risk factors, realistic goals, and appropriate dietary and exercise modifications tailored to your individual health status.

4. Implementable Strategies for Sustainable Weight Management

Implementable Strategies for Sustainable Weight Management

Sustainable weight management is best achieved through consistent, evidence-based habits rather than restrictive short-term measures. The core principle is creating a moderate, sustainable energy deficit while preserving muscle mass and metabolic health.

Dietary Strategies with Strong Evidence

High-quality evidence supports a focus on dietary quality and structure over extreme restriction.

  • Prioritize Protein and Fiber: Consuming adequate protein (e.g., 1.2–1.6 g/kg of body weight) and dietary fiber promotes satiety, helps preserve lean mass during weight loss, and supports metabolic health.
  • Mindful Caloric Awareness: Tracking intake or using portion control strategies (like the plate method) creates awareness. This is not about obsessive counting but understanding energy density.
  • Limit Ultra-Processed Foods: Reducing intake of sugar-sweetened beverages, refined carbohydrates, and highly processed snacks is strongly linked to better weight control and health outcomes.

Exercise for Metabolism and Adherence

Exercise supports weight loss primarily by preserving metabolism and improving body composition, not through massive calorie burn alone.

  • Combine Strength and Cardio: Resistance training 2-3 times weekly is crucial for maintaining muscle. Moderate-intensity cardio (e.g., 150-300 minutes/week) aids the energy deficit and cardiovascular health.
  • Focus on Non-Exercise Activity (NEAT): Increasing daily movement—walking, taking stairs—is a sustainable way to boost total energy expenditure without requiring structured workout time.

Behavioral and Psychological Foundations

Long-term success hinges on behavior change. Evidence supports strategies like self-monitoring (e.g., food or exercise journals), setting specific process goals ("walk 30 minutes daily"), and building consistent routines. Cognitive-behavioral techniques to manage stress-related eating can also be beneficial, though individual results vary.

Clinical Perspective: Sustainability requires a "diet" you can maintain indefinitely. Drastic cuts in calories or entire food groups often lead to rebound weight gain. The most effective strategy is the one tailored to an individual's lifestyle, preferences, and health status, making professional guidance valuable. Weight loss of 1-2 pounds per week is a safe, evidence-based benchmark.

Important Considerations: Individuals with a history of eating disorders, significant metabolic conditions (e.g., diabetes, thyroid disorders), kidney disease (regarding high protein intake), or those taking multiple medications should consult a physician or registered dietitian before implementing significant dietary or exercise changes. Rapid weight loss goals, such as losing 20 pounds in 2 months, are at the upper limit of recommended rates and may not be appropriate or sustainable for everyone.

5. Indicators for Medical Evaluation and Professional Oversight

Indicators for Medical Evaluation and Professional Oversight

While the goal of losing 20 pounds in two months is ambitious, it is crucial to recognize that such a significant caloric deficit and intense exercise regimen are not appropriate or safe for everyone. Professional oversight is not a sign of weakness but a cornerstone of responsible, sustainable health management. Medical evaluation helps identify underlying conditions, tailor the plan to your physiology, and mitigate risks.

You should strongly consider consulting a physician or a registered dietitian before embarking on this plan if you have any of the following indicators:

  • Pre-existing medical conditions: This includes cardiovascular disease, type 1 or 2 diabetes, hypertension, kidney or liver disease, thyroid disorders, or a history of eating disorders.
  • Current medication use: Certain medications for diabetes, blood pressure, or mental health can interact with diet and exercise, requiring dose adjustments under medical supervision.
  • Significant weight history: A history of yo-yo dieting, previous weight loss surgery, or a starting Body Mass Index (BMI) in the underweight or morbidly obese categories.
  • Persistent symptoms: Unexplained fatigue, dizziness, chest pain, shortness of breath with minimal exertion, or significant joint pain.
  • Specific life stages: Pregnancy, breastfeeding, or being under the age of 18 or over 65, as nutritional and caloric needs differ substantially.

Clinical Insight: From a medical perspective, a loss of 20 pounds in 60 days represents an average deficit of roughly 1,200 calories per day. This is a substantial physiological stressor. A clinician will assess your metabolic health, screen for contraindications, and may recommend baseline labs (e.g., lipid panel, fasting glucose, electrolytes) to establish a safe starting point. They can also help differentiate between lean mass and fat loss, which rapid programs often fail to address adequately.

The evidence strongly supports that weight loss interventions supervised by healthcare professionals lead to better adherence, more favorable body composition outcomes, and fewer adverse events compared to unsupervised attempts. The evidence for specific "rapid" protocols, however, is often limited by short study durations and lack of long-term follow-up on weight maintenance.

Ultimately, seeking professional guidance ensures your plan is not only effective but also safe, personalized, and sustainable for your long-term health.

Is losing 20 pounds in 2 months a realistic and healthy goal for everyone?

This goal represents a weekly weight loss of 2.5 pounds, which exceeds the commonly recommended 1-2 pounds per week for sustainable loss. While it is mathematically possible, especially for individuals with a higher starting weight, it is an aggressive target. The primary concern is that rapid weight loss often involves severe calorie restriction, which can lead to significant loss of lean muscle mass, nutrient deficiencies, and a substantial drop in metabolic rate, making long-term weight maintenance more difficult. For most people, a goal of 1-2 pounds per week is more sustainable and health-promoting. It's crucial to assess your starting point; this pace may be more attainable for someone needing to lose 100+ pounds than for someone with only 30 pounds to lose.

Expert Insight: Clinicians often view rapid weight loss targets with caution. The body's physiological adaptations—like increased hunger hormones and reduced energy expenditure—actively resist large, quick deficits. A slower approach focused on habit change is less likely to trigger these compensatory mechanisms, improving the odds of keeping the weight off long-term.

What are the potential risks or side effects of following such an intense plan, and who should avoid it?

Aggressive diet and exercise combos carry several risks. Physically, they can lead to gallstones, electrolyte imbalances, severe fatigue, hormonal disruptions (e.g., irregular periods), and increased injury risk from overtraining. Psychologically, they can foster an unhealthy, restrictive relationship with food and may trigger or exacerbate eating disorders. This approach is strongly discouraged for, and should be avoided by: individuals with a history of eating disorders; those with underlying heart, kidney, or liver conditions; pregnant or breastfeeding women; people with type 1 diabetes or unstable type 2 diabetes; and anyone on multiple medications, especially for blood pressure or blood sugar, as needs can change rapidly. Older adults and adolescents also require tailored, medically supervised approaches.

When should I talk to a doctor before starting, and what should I bring to that appointment?

Consult a physician or a registered dietitian before starting any significant weight loss plan, especially an aggressive one. This is essential if you have any chronic health conditions (e.g., diabetes, hypertension, heart disease), take regular medications, are over 40 with a sedentary history, or have a history of weight cycling or disordered eating. For the appointment, bring: a list of all medications and supplements; a summary of the proposed diet and exercise plan; your personal health and weight history; and specific, prepared questions. Key topics to discuss are: adjusting medication doses (for diabetes/blood pressure), screening for underlying conditions that could be affected, ensuring nutritional adequacy, and establishing safer, monitored milestones. This transforms a DIY plan into a supervised health strategy.

Expert Insight: A pre-planning doctor's visit is a sign of responsibility, not weakness. It allows for baseline measurements (like blood pressure and lab values) that create objective benchmarks for success beyond the scale, such as improved cholesterol or blood sugar control. This data is invaluable for tracking health gains that aren't reflected in weight alone.

How much of the weight loss is likely to be fat versus water or muscle, and how can I preserve muscle?

In the first week of any calorie deficit, a significant portion of weight loss is water and glycogen (stored carbohydrates). With an aggressive plan, this initial water loss can be pronounced. The risk of losing lean muscle mass increases substantially with very low-calorie diets and excessive cardio without strength training. To maximize fat loss and preserve metabolically active muscle, evidence strongly supports two concurrent strategies: 1) Consuming adequate protein (aim for 0.7-1 gram per pound of target body weight daily) to support muscle synthesis and satiety, and 2) Engaging in progressive resistance training (weight lifting, bodyweight exercises) at least 2-3 times per week. The scale alone cannot distinguish composition; tracking measurements, strength gains, and how clothes fit provides a more complete picture.
